Concern is growing for two LGBTQ+ activists who have reportedly been imprisoned by the Taliban in Afghanistan. According to the Afghan LGBTQ+ nonprofit Roshaniya, Lesbian woman Maryam Ravish, 19, and Trans woman Maeve Alcina Pieescu, 23, were arrested while trying to board a Mahan Airlines flight to Tehran from Kabul on March 20th, with Maryam’s partner Parwen Hussaini.

Almost two years have passed since news broke that one of the world’s most famous drag queens had passed away, yet major questions about what happened to her remain unanswered. Heklina (Steven Grygelko), was found dead by close friend Peaches Christ on 3 April 2023 at the flat the two of them were renting in Soho, London – though a cause of death is yet to be confirmed, and the Met Police took until January 2025 to release CCTV of potential suspects.

Edward II is a play which considers the question: what would happen if the King of England was in love with a demon twunk? The RSC’s new adaptation of Christopher Marlowe’s classic historical play tells the tragic true story of King Edward II, whose love of “favourite” Piers Gaveston led to a political breakdown between himself and his magnates.

Up to 10.8 million more people could be infected with HIV globally by 2030 as a result of aid cuts made by Donald Trump and Keir Starmer. Modelling published in the Lancet HIV medical journal on 26 March says that a decade of progress in the fight against HIV and AIDS could be lost, unless the funding can be found elsewhere.
